The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Alexander W Anderson, born in 1830 in Saddleworth, Yorkshire, consisted of 6 members. Alexander W was the head of the household, married to Esther M Anderson, born in 1829 in Saddleworth, Yorkshire, England. They had 4 children; James W (born 1856 in Saddleworth, Yorkshire, England), Fred S (born 1861 in Saddleworth, Yorkshire, England), Thomas M (born 1864 in Saddleworth, Yorkshire, England) and Jane A (born 1868 in Saddleworth, Yorkshire, England).
